Circuit/System Description

The Transmission Internal Mode Switch contains 9 separate switches in one assembly. The other 4 electronic switches are called the transmission range switches and are used to indicate the gear position the vehicle operator has selected. The Transmission Internal Mode Switch is mounted on the interior left side of the transmission case. The internal mode switch assembly is a dual sliding Hall Effect switch. The nine outputs from the switch indicate which position is selected by the transmission manual shaft. Four outputs (A, B, C, P), are range selection inputs to the transmission control module (TCM). Five outputs (R1, R2, D1, D2 and S) are direction selection inputs to the Hybrid/EV Powertrain Control Module 1, through the transmission X175 connector. The input voltage at the modules is high when the switch is open and low when the switch is closed to ground. The state of each input is displayed on the scan tool as Internal Mode Switch Range and Internal Mode Switch Direction. The Internal Mode Switch Range input parameters represented are transmission range signal A, signal B, signal C and signal P. The Internal Mode Switch Direction input parameters represented are transmission direction signal R1, signal R2, signal D1, signal D2 and signal Start. The Transmission Internal Mode Switch indicates to the TCM which Range position the vehicle operator has selected. The Transmission Internal Mode Switch consists of 9 separate Hall Effect switches. Each Hall Effect switch is supplied a 9 V signal circuit from the TCM. Each signal circuit for each gear selector position will have either a voltage reading of 0.70-0.96 V indicting ON or 1.68-2.38 V indicating OFF. The voltage values on each Transmission Internal Mode Switch circuit will change and are dependent on the position of the gear selector. The state of each Transmission Internal Mode Switch A/B/C/P/S circuit is displayed on the scan tool.
